GENERAL INFORMATION

The 2 ½ day course will offer intensive instruction of IICL reefer container inspection and repair. Other topics planned for the course will be drawn from the following: reefer body and machinery construction and operation, refrigerant conversions and CFC's. Depot sessions will provide practical demonstrations of principles discussed in class. Students will practice inspecting damaged reefers, observe repairs in progress (including foaming), participate in PTI reviews and view CFC conversions. Prior to the course, students will be asked to submit questions regarding the machinery portion of the equipment, which will be answered by guest speakers.

Experienced technical experts in the reefer container field will lead classes. The course textbook used is the second edition of the IICL General Guide for Refrigerated Container Inspection and Repair, a copy of which will be provided to all registered students.

In order to maintain a high level of individual attention, enrollment will be limited. Early registration is recommended to ensure a place in the course. The course will be conducted in English.

The classes will be conducted at Southeastern Trailer and Container Repair depot in order to maximize time spent reviewing damages, repairs and presentation by guest speakers.
